1H14
Structure of a cold-adapted family 8 xylanase
X-RAY DIFFRACTION
Crystallization
Crystalization Experiments | ||||
---|---|---|---|---|
ID | Method | pH | Temperature | Details |
1 | VAPOR DIFFUSION, HANGING DROP | 7 | 277 | TAKE 2 - 10 MG/ML PROTEIN IN 20MM MOPS,50MM NACL, 2% TREHALOSE, PH 7.5, ADD EQUAL VOLUME OF 70% MPD, 0.1M PHOSPHATE BUFFER PH 7.0 IN A HANGING DROP EXPERIMENT AT 4 DEGREES CENTIGRADE. SUCCESS RATE 1/20 |
